Get ready to explore and create groundbreaking innovations in technology and science through this dual degree program. Over four years, this combined program will give you specialized training in computer science alongside comprehensive mathematical knowledge. Computer science blends theoretical algorithm and data structure studies with hands-on experience in building hardware and software solutions. The skills you acquire will be applicable across diverse fields from bioinformatics to digital humanities. You'll cultivate robust analytical, logical, and technical capabilities to push computing and its applications forward. Specialization options include cyber security, data science, machine learning, programming languages, or scientific computing. The mathematics component will help you build either deep expertise in a specific mathematical field or broad proficiency in mathematical applications. With modern computing, scientific advancements, and growing data generation transforming how mathematics is used, your career possibilities expand into finance, economics, IT, and molecular biology. Employers increasingly value graduates with advanced quantitative and analytical skills to drive progress in these evolving fields.
As digital systems grow more interconnected and service-rich, protecting them becomes both more complex and more critical. The cyber security specialization teaches you core principles and methods to defend computing systems - from smartphones and vehicle computers to servers - against attacks, damage, or unauthorized access. You'll master secure coding practices and ethical hacking techniques to protect individuals, corporations, and government entities from cyber threats.
